This is a model of a halfling witch mounted on a pony. It would also work well with a wizard. I designed the original model in DesktopHero3D, and modified it using MeshMixer.Attributionsbacker71 (Muscled Arm Left)backer71 (Muscled Arm Right)Xenon472 (Basic hood)backer71 (Male Head)DeltaFoxtrotZulu (Platform Hex)The licenses for the individual assets used are:Muscled Arm Left (Creative Commons - Attribution)left hand closed (Creative Commons - Public Domain Dedication)thick neck (Creative Commons - Public Domain Dedication)Muscled Arm Right (Creative Commons - Attribution)Simple Tunic (Creative Commons - Public Domain Dedication)right hand closed (Creative Commons - Public Domain Dedication)Basic hood (Creative Commons - Attribution)Male Short Pants (Creative Commons - Public Domain Dedication)Male Head (Creative Commons - Attribution)Male Sandals (Creative Commons - Public Domain Dedication)gnarled staff (Creative Commons - Public Domain Dedication)male body (Creative Commons - Public Domain Dedication)Platform Hex (Creative Commons - Attribution - Share Alike)cloak cape (Creative Commons - Public Domain Dedication)cloak cape (Creative Commons - Public Domain Dedication)
